OverviewThis book introduces the research process and principles of the controlled super-coupling nuclear fusion experiment at the Experimental Advanced Superconducting Tokamak (EAST) nuclear fusion reactor in Hefei, China. It uses straightforward language to explain how nuclear fusion can provide safe, environmentally friendly, clean, and inexhaustible energy in future. EAST is the world’s first fully superconducting, non-circular cross-section tokamak nuclear fusion experimental device, independently developed by the Chinese Academy of Sciences. This book helps demonstrate China’s cutting-edge scientific and technological advances to the rest of the world, helps spread the scientific spirit to people around the globe, and promotes prosperity and development. The book is intended for all non-experts who would like to learn more about nuclear energy and related technologies. Memorabilia."ReviewsAuthor InformationDr. Baonian Wan is a director of the Institute of Plasma Physics, Chinese Academy of Sciences, Hefei, China. He received Ph.D. degree from University of Würzburg, Germany, in 1991. He has engaged in tokamak plasma diagnosis and physics experiments for decades and has made a series of major achievements in the HT-7 superconducting tokamak physics experiment.
